我一直试图React Native
通过"Over The Air"方式发布一些iOS App(开发版)的新版本.我有一个Entreprise帐户.此外,我之前使用相同的应用程序完成了此操作.这是第一次失败.
我一直在调查很多,这里有一些我可以提供的信息:
XCode:10.1 React Native:0.57.5部署目标:9.3
我重新创建了我的证书和配置文件.我的签名资料看起来像 这看起来对我有效.
我正在通过普通网页下载应用程序,下载链接如下所示:
<a href="itms-services://?action=download-manifest&url=https://example.com/path/to/the/manifest.plist">
Download iOS
</a>
Run Code Online (Sandbox Code Playgroud)
我想发布一个带有App Thinning的版本All compatible device variants
.清单对我来说看起来很正常,但我有些疑问.在此版本之前,在清单中,生成的二进制文件如下所示:MyApp-iPhone%207%20Plus-etc.ipa
.现在,因为我更新XCode
(从10
到10.1
,如果我的记忆是好的),他们是这样的:MyApp-0AB530E1-7309-4293-B4B6-C0AD90662766.ipa
.
我也验证了App URL
,它们Display Image URL
和Full Size Image URL
它们中的三个是有效的.
最后,我在进入失败的安装过程中检查了日志Window -> Devices and Simulators -> Open Console -> Errors and Failures
.以下是我可以告诉我安装失败的所有日志.我在谷歌上做了几项研究,却一无所获.
[PlaceholderUtility]: Failed artwork for bundleID: My.Bundle.Identifier error: Error Domain=SSErrorDomain Code=3 "Connexion à l’iTunes Store impossible" UserInfo={NSLocalizedDescription=Connexion …
Run Code Online (Sandbox Code Playgroud) 我目前正在尝试在我的react-native应用程序上实现自动隐藏标头.感谢这个例子,我设法做到了,但它破坏了一些东西.事实上onEndReached
,当我到达列表末尾时,我的方法不再被调用.我也使用该RefreshControl
组件来实现一个pull-to-refresh
有效但这AnimatedScrollView
似乎干扰了经典的ListView功能.
我创建了一个AnimatedScrollView
这样的组件:
const AnimatedScrollView = Animated.createAnimatedComponent(ScrollView);
Run Code Online (Sandbox Code Playgroud)
这是我的组件的渲染:
<View>
<AnimatedScrollView
...someProps
>
<ListView
...someOtherProps
/>
</AnimatedScrollView>
<Animated.View>
<Text>My Header Title</Text>
</Animated.View>
</View>
Run Code Online (Sandbox Code Playgroud)
正如我所说的那样,我很确定AnimatedScrollView
滚动功能会覆盖它们ListView
,但我不知道如何解决这个问题......
如果你们有一个提示/知道一个解决方法,或者甚至知道一个可以帮助我标题的库,我将不胜感激:)
对于那些现在想要表达的东西someProps
,它们与我链接的示例完全相同.
谢谢
我一直试图在一个输入TextInput
中捕捉键盘的事件react-native
。
通过阅读组件的文档(https://facebook.github.io/react-native/docs/textinput.html),我注意到该onKeyPress
函数完全符合我的需要。但它被标记为ios
唯一。android
除了这个问题(https://github.com/facebook/react-native/issues/1882)之外,我没有找到任何关于解决方法的信息,这个问题已经有几个月没有活动了......
我需要做的是在Backspace
按下时调用一个特定的方法,看起来它只能暂时完成ios
......
你们知道任何解决方法吗?
提前致谢 :)
我确实为我的应用程序设置了一些e2e
测试。我正在使用命令手动运行这些测试,但我找不到(无论是在 detox 的问题中,还是在 Fastlane 的文档中)直接在 Fastlane 中集成这些测试的方法。这些选项似乎都不适合我正在寻找的内容。detox
react-native
detox test
任何人之前都设法实现了这一点,还是我必须为此找到解决方法?
提前致谢!
我正在使用 Razor 在 MVC 4.5 中开发一个网站,我需要将 2 个网站放在Html.BeginForm
同一页面上。正如我注意到的那样,并在互联网上阅读它,同一页面上的两个表格不能正常工作。
我尝试使用runat='server'
,但这也不起作用,但我看到了这篇文章: http: //www.quora.com/How-do-I-use-2-forms-in-a-single-ASP-NET-在服务器上运行的页面,一个家伙说:
在 MVC 中,由于使用 Form 标签,这非常容易。:-)
可悲的是,他没有确切说明应该做什么,这是我仍然拥有的唯一线索。
所以如果有人知道我该怎么做......
更多精度:
我的两个都@using (Html.BeginForm)
在不同的页面上工作得很好,并且他们提交了完全不同的数据。我已经考虑过混合它们并在控制器的方法中处理混合,但这太棒了:/
感谢您的帮助 !
我在我的cordova项目中得到了这个问题,用角度和离子创建.我已尽力而为,但它无法正常工作.
这是代码:
function getSuccess(response) {
$scope.modules = response.modules;
$scope.list = $scope.modules;
$scope.search = [
{str: ""}
];
}
$http({method: 'GET',
url: "http://xxx.xxx.xxx.xxx/api/modules"
})
.success(getSuccess)
.error(function (response){
alert("Damned");
});
Run Code Online (Sandbox Code Playgroud)
当然,IP是有效的,并且在Chrome浏览器中工作;)那是在我的控制器中.我已经<access origin="*"/>
在我的配置文件中添加了它,在构建之后它仍然在我的Android设备上显示"Damned".
Cordova版本:5.0.0 Android版本:5.1
我遗憾地没有找到任何正确的答案.
我目前正在开发一个反应原生的应用程序,redux
我发现一些开发工具使发布版本变慢了.
这是一个例子:
const store = createStore(
Reducers,
composeWithDevTools(
applyMiddleware(thunk),
),
);
Run Code Online (Sandbox Code Playgroud)
这composeWithDevTools
显然是一些开发工具,release
我应该使用另一个函数调用compose
.我想做的事情是这样的:
//development
const store = createStore(
Reducers,
composeWithDevTools(
applyMiddleware(thunk),
),
);
//production
const store = createStore(
Reducers,
composeWithDevTools(
applyMiddleware(thunk),
),
);
//end
Run Code Online (Sandbox Code Playgroud)
考虑到我在哪里,它会自动选择正确的代码示例.(开发或发布).
你们知道我可以使用的一些工具吗?
提前致谢
react-native ×5
android ×3
ios ×2
reactjs ×2
angularjs ×1
asp.net ×1
asp.net-mvc ×1
cordova ×1
detox ×1
fastlane ×1
forms ×1
html ×1
iphone ×1
javascript ×1
jestjs ×1
onkeypress ×1
razor ×1
textinput ×1
xcode ×1